True born businessmen” this is what comes to my mind when I talk about Fiandino’s family.

Fiandino’s history starts in the ’20 s with grandpa Magno who bought Cascina Palazzo in Villafalletto, close to the city of Cuneo to start cattle breeding. On summer, he used to take cattle up to the Alps where the springs of Stura di Demonte river originate, in a kind of fairy tales landscape. Later on, at the end of 40’s his sons Giovanni, Luigi and Battista built up the cheese factory.
Since long time ago, Fiandino’s family shows itself a far-seeing one, giving start to the short production and distribution chain, straight from the producer to the consumer. Breeding, farming, milk processing and selling in the same place: all in one!
Today Egidio and Mario, heirs of Nonno Magno experience carry successfully on Fiandino company and sell all over the universe. Well….let’s say just over the known part of it!
